Model Name: Amazon 1.1 HLS MK2
Chassis type: Hatchback
The Amazon was a subcompact hatchback produced by the senglish automaker Dover Engineering Stillhon from 1976 to 1984,
produced through two generations.
Developed one year after the Smoogo 720 was put on the market,
the Dover Amazon was one of the rivals of the simoviet hatchback. Indeed, the Stillhon automaker, in order to make this car,
they've been directly inspired by the 720: it featured a plastic chassis, like its simoviet rival,
and its engine was a simple 1.1 three cylinders, that gave a good fuel economy to the car,
and its suspensions were the trademark "Liquoplasm" used on Dovers.
Aimed at a youthful target, the Amazon had a good success,
although without reaching completely the high sellings of the market-leader 720.
The second generation, that made its debut in 1980, featured a lot of improvements than the previous one,
such as the bodywork that now was made of metal instead of plastic, and the mechanics were improved and revised.
The styling of the Amazon mk2 was a sort of an anticipation of its successor, the Dover Marin.
It has been discontinued in 1984.
